萬盛學電腦網

 萬盛學電腦網 >> 網絡編程 >> asp編程 >> ASP常用函數

ASP常用函數

  1  數學函數
  1.1 取整函數
  int(x)       取不大於x的最大整數。
  fix(x)       捨去x的小數部分。
  1.2 絕對值函數
  abs(x)       求x的絕對值。
  1.3 符號函數
  sgn(x)       求x的符號代碼,x為負數時函數值為-1 。
  1.4 平方根函數
  sqr(x)       求x的算術平方根,x必須大於0 。
  1.5 指數函數
  exp(x)       求以e為底x為指數的值。
  1.6 對數函數
  log(x)       求以e為底的對數函數值。
  1.7 三角函數
  sin(x)       求x的正弦值。
  con(x)       求x的余弦值。
  tan(x)       求x的正切值。
  Atn(x)       求x的反正切值。
  1.8 數制轉換函數
  hex(x)       十進制轉換為對應的十六進制數。
  oct(x)       十進制轉換為對應的八進制數。
  2  日期時間函數
  2.1 系統日期時間函數
  now()        讀取系統當前日期時間。
  date()       讀取系統當前日期。
  time()       讀取系統當前時間。
  2.2 日期時間分解函數
  year(日期字符串)     返回日期字符串中的年份。
  month(日期字符串)    返回日期字符串中的月份。
  day(日期字符串)      返回日期字符串中的日子。
  weekday(日期字符串)  返回日期字符串中的星期。
  hour(時間字符串)     返回時間字符串中的小時。
  minute(時間字符串)   返回時間字符串中的分鐘。
  secont(時間字符串)   返回時間字符串中的秒數。
  2.3 日期時間數值化函數
  dateValue(日期字符串) 把日期字符串轉換為當日至1889-12-30的天數。
  timeValue(時間字符串) 把時間字符串轉換為0~1之間變體型時間值。
  2.4 日期時間運算函數
  dateSerial(年,月,日)  把年月日連接成日期字符串。
  timeSerial(時,分,秒)  把時分秒連接成時間字符串。
  timer()                計算午夜起至當前系統時間所歷經的秒數。 
  3  字符串處理函數
  3.1 刪除空格函數
  Trim(字符串)         刪除字符串兩端空格字符。
  LTrim(字符串)        刪除字符串左端空格字符。
  RTrim(字符串)        刪除字符串右端空格字符。


  3.2 截取字符函數
  left(字符串,n)       截取字符串左端n個字符。
  right(字符串,n)     截取字符串右端n個字符。
  mid(字符串,n,m)      截取字符串中間從m個字符起的n個字符。
  mid(字符串,m)        截取字符串第m個字符起至末尾的所有字符。
  3.3 字符測長函數
  len(字符串)        返回字符串中所包含的字符個數。
  3.4 字符生成函數
  string(n,字符串)     生成n個字符串首字母。
  space(n)             生成n個空格。
  3.5 大小寫轉換函數
  Ucase(字符串)        把字符串中的字母轉換為大寫字母。
  Lcase(字符串)        把字符串中的字母轉換為小寫字母。
  3.6 字符轉換函數
  chr(表達式)        求以表達式值為ASCII碼的對應字符。
  asc(字符串)        求字符串中首字符的ASCII碼。
  val(字符串)        把字符串中的數字轉換為對應的數值。
  str(數值表達式)    把數值表達式的值轉換為對應的字符串。
  4  數據類型轉換函數
  4.1 轉整型函數
  Cint(數值表達式)   把數值表達式的值轉換為整型,小數四捨五入。
  4.2 轉長整型函數
  Clng(數值表達式)   把數值表達式值轉換為長整型,小數四捨五入。
  4.3 轉貨幣型函數
  Ccur(數值表達式)   把數值表達式值轉換為貨幣型,小數四捨五入。
  4.4 轉雙精度型函數
  Cdbl(數值表達式)   把數值表達式值轉換為雙精度型。
  4.5 轉單精度型函數
  Csng(數值表達式)   把數值表達式值轉換為單精度型。
  4.6 轉日期型函數
  Cdate(表達式)      把表達式值轉換為日期型。    (.)
  4.7 轉變體型函數
  Cvar(表達式)       把表達式值轉換為變體型。
  5  輸出格式函數
  5.1 時間格式函數
  Format(日期時間字符串,格式字符)   按照格式字符規定的格式輸出日期時間字符串。一般使用"yyyy-mm-dd hh:mm:ss"格式。
  5.2 數值格式函數
  Format(數值表達式,格式字符)       按照格式字符規定的格式輸出數值表達式的值。
  formatNumber(x,2)     取小數點後兩位
  6 交互式函數
  6.1 輸入函數
  InputBox(提示信息[,標題][,默認數據])   產生一個對話框作為用戶輸入數據的界面,並返回輸入的內容。
  6.2 輸出函數
  MsgBox(信息內容[,界面風格參數][,標題])  產生一個對話框作為反饋一些信息用來提示用戶。

copyright © 萬盛學電腦網 all rights reserved